2003 Toyota Camry LE review from North America
"Not happy about the problem with the evaporation canister"
What things have gone wrong with the car?
Brakes and tires have been replaced.
Check engine light came on, and I took it to local mechanic who diagnosed it as a problem with the evaporation canister. Toyota will charge $400-$600 to fix. I am over the 3 year warranty, but under 50,000, and want to know if this seems to be a defect with 2003 Toyota Camrys?
